Luo Fuli’s rise to prominence in the world of AI was not a smooth path, but one marked by perseverance, intelligence, and an unwavering passion for technology. Her academic journey began at Beijing Normal University, where she initially faced challenges in computer science. However, her dedication paid off as she excelled in the field, leading her to the prestigious Peking University’s Institute of Computational Linguistics. There, she achieved a remarkable feat by publishing eight research papers at the esteemed ACL (Association for Computational Linguistics) conference in 2019, solidifying her place as a rising star in the field.
Her accomplishments caught the attention of major tech companies in China, including Alibaba and Xiaomi. Luo’s expertise led her to a role at Alibaba’s DAMO Academy, where she played a pivotal part in developing the VECO multilingual pre-training model. She also contributed significantly to the open-source AliceMind project, cementing her reputation as a leading voice in NLP and AI research.

Luo Fuli’s Recognition and Influence
Luo Fuli’s exceptional talent has not gone unnoticed. Her groundbreaking work at DeepSeek has solidified her as one of China’s most influential figures in the AI space. Her contributions to the development of DeepSeek’s advanced models have been critical in positioning the company as a major player in the global AI race.
Luo’s expertise has also garnered the attention of China’s top tech leaders. Xiaomi’s founder, Lei Jun, reportedly offered Luo an annual compensation package of 10 million yuan, a recognition of her immense value to the industry and her potential to drive future innovations. This offer reflects Luo’s status as one of the most sought-after AI experts in China, with her ability to develop world-class AI technologies at a fraction of the cost of US competitors.
